As a Vet

You will be accountable for patient care within the clinic, whilst ensuring we deliver exceptional care, always there for our clients, patients, and colleagues whilst maintaining the highest levels of regulatory and operational standards and compliance.

Responsibilities

Client care

  • Deliver exceptional care to clients, each and every day.
  • Deal with any client complaints and concerns raised in the clinic.
  • Ensure the client receives updates regarding patient care following any procedure.
  • For any out of hours (OOH) or enhanced care, ensure the client is updated regarding patient care and wellbeing.

Patient care

  • Carry out any consultations and procedures.
  • Accountable for patient care and monitoring.
  • Responsible for admissions and discharges for procedures (depending on complexity).
  • Ensure patient records are accurate and up to date.
  • Complete a clinical handover and make arrangements for the transfer of any patient requiring OOH or enhanced care.
  • Responsible for prescribing medication and carrying out dispensing checks.
  • All patient care is carried out under the guidance of the vet/lead vet in line with clinical competence.

Standards and Compliance

  • Accountable for compliance with all regulatory and practice standards and agreed ways of working.
  • Ensure the appropriate regulatory, practice, and operational veterinary and nursing standards are implemented in the practice.
  • Ensure compliance with health and safety requirements.

Commercial performance

  • Prepare accurate estimates and costs for clients and ensure payment is made at the same time as the procedure.
  • Take action to minimise debt and support action plans to address any issues with clients.
  • Maximise capacity through the most effective utilisation of clinical skills.

Clinical leadership

  • Support and carry out colleague clinical mentoring/development as required.
  • Pro-actively support and share clinical best practice within and across clinics and the wider Medivet community.

To continue to deliver exceptional care to clients, the Vets are responsible for mentoring graduates within the clinic. The Nurse and Head Nurse are responsible for coaching the nursing team.

Clinical administration

  • Accountable for ensuring lab tests are carried out correctly.
  • Escalate any issues to the Practice Manager as required.

Skills, knowledge, and experience

  • Must be an RCVS registered vet surgeon.
  • Able to demonstrate clinical leadership skills.
  • Implementation of a progressive clinical culture.
  • Able to work as part of a team.
  • Experienced in delivering exceptional clinical care to clients and patients.
  • Supports nurse consults and understands how this contributes to the performance and efficient operation of the clinic.
  • Experienced in using coaching and influencing skills to get the best out of each and every colleague.
  • Supporting the weekend rota 1:6 and bank holiday rota.

Our clinics are run by small teams who need to work together effectively to deliver exceptional care to our clients, patients, and colleagues. This means that, from time to time, you may be required to carry out tasks outside your normal duties, where you have the skills, knowledge, and experience required.
